Glacial Rx is a hyaluronic acid-based dermal filler that is commonly used to address various signs of aging, such as fine lines, wrinkles, and volume loss in the face. The longevity of Glacial Rx can vary depending on several factors, including the individual's metabolism, the area of treatment, and the amount of filler used.
Generally, Glacial Rx can last between 6 to 12 months in Salford, with most patients experiencing the optimal results for around 9 to 12 months. The duration of the treatment can be influenced by the individual's unique physiology and the specific areas of the face that are treated.
For example, Glacial Rx tends to last longer in areas of the face that have less movement, such as the cheeks or the temples, compared to areas with more dynamic movement, like the lips or the nasolabial folds. Additionally, patients with a slower metabolism may find that the filler lasts longer, as the body takes more time to break down and metabolize the hyaluronic acid.
It's important to note that the longevity of Glacial Rx can also be affected by factors such as sun exposure, facial expressions, and the individual's overall skin health. Patients who engage in activities that involve significant facial movements or are exposed to harsh environmental conditions may find that the filler breaks down more quickly.
To maintain the desired results from Glacial Rx, patients in Salford may need to undergo touch-up treatments every 9 to 12 months, depending on their individual needs and the areas treated. These touch-up treatments can help to maintain the youthful and rejuvenated appearance achieved with the initial Glacial Rx procedure.
In conclusion, Glacial Rx is a highly effective dermal filler that can provide long-lasting results for patients in Salford. However, the exact duration of the treatment can vary from individual to individual, and regular touch-up treatments may be necessary to maintain the desired aesthetic outcomes.
